According to the article ‘BEHAVIORIST THEORY ON LANGUAGE LEARNING AND ACQUISITION’, which one (1) of these teaching techniques d
igomit [66]

Answer:

2. collaborative learning (pair work/group work)

Explanation:

The Behaviorist Theory of language learning and acquisition focuses on skill development of infants and young children. The theory presents a model that sheds light on the development of skills and language learning process in infants that is used for acquiring the needed language speaking ability. The theory suggests that it is done by watching and imitating the parents and other people in the surrounding and then inducting new words based on the reward they have got for the earlier imitation and practice. Hence, option 1 and option 3 can be considered a part of Behaviorist Theory but option 2,  collaborative learning is not suggested by the theory.
